Nicholas Trask hired as Mason City boys basketball coach

logo-MohawksMASON CITY – The Mason City school district confirmed the hiring of Nicholas Trask as the new boys basketball coach.

A district document says that Trask will assume the Head Varsity Boys Basketball Coach position at a rate of pay of $6,435 (2013-2014 Collective Bargaining Agreement). Trask is a teacher at Mason City High School and is originally from Charles City.

Adam Callanan was the previous coach. His overall record was 39-78 and 5-17 last season.

An online stat book shows that Mason City has won five state titles (1935, 1940, 1943, 1996, 1997) with the last two under former coach Bob Horner, who was passed up for this open coaching position.
